Description
Perfectly positioned on the iconic waterfront of Aberdyfi, Awel Dyfi is a remarkable five-bedroom period residence commanding breathtaking, uninterrupted views across the Dyfi Estuary towards Cardigan Bay. Occupying one of the most enviable positions within this picturesque coastal village, the property effortlessly combines timeless character with generous family accommodation extending to approximately 1,744 sq ft.
Rarely does a home offer such a captivating relationship with its surroundings. From the elevated front garden and principal reception rooms to the front-facing bedrooms above, the ever-changing estuary provides a spectacular backdrop throughout the seasons. Sunrises over the water, sailing boats drifting across the bay and dramatic coastal sunsets become part of everyday life.
Currently operating as a highly successful holiday let, Awel Dyfi offers outstanding versatility, whether as an impressive permanent residence, luxurious coastal retreat or investment opportunity.
GROUND FLOOR
A welcoming entrance hall leads to two beautifully proportioned reception rooms. The elegant front lounge enjoys magnificent estuary views through a bay window, whilst the spacious dining room provides the perfect setting for entertaining. To the rear, the well-appointed kitchen offers ample preparation space and direct access to the courtyard garden.
FIRST FLOOR
The first floor hosts three generous double bedrooms, two benefiting from En-suite facilities. The principal bedroom (14'11" x 11'0") enjoys commanding coastal views, whilst two further bedrooms measure 14'11" x 9'5" and 12'7" x 11'0" respectively. A separate cloakroom completes the accommodation.
SECOND FLOOR
The upper floor provides two further double bedrooms, both measuring approximately 14'9" x 9'5", together with a family shower room. These rooms offer flexible accommodation ideal for guests, extended family or home-working requirements.
OUTSIDE
One of Awel Dyfi's most distinctive features is its elevated front garden terrace, a truly rare asset within Aberdyfi. Positioned to maximise the spectacular estuary outlook, it offers an idyllic space for outdoor dining, relaxation and entertaining. To the rear, a substantial slate courtyard provides further outdoor living space, with gated access and steps rising to an elevated garden arranged over two levels.
